Know all about Adamellite and Pseudotachylite properties here. All properties of rocks are important as they define the type of rock and its application. Adamellite belongs to Igneous Rocks while Pseudotachylite belongs to Metamorphic Rocks.Texture of Adamellite is Porphyritic whereas that of Pseudotachylite is Quench. Adamellite appears Veined or Pebbled and Pseudotachylite appears Dull and Soft. The luster of Adamellite is dull to grainy with sporadic parts pearly and vitreous while that of Pseudotachylite is vitreous. Adamellite is available in black, grey, orange, pink, white colors whereas Pseudotachylite is available in black, brown, colourless, green, grey, pink, white colors. The commercial uses of Adamellite are curling, gemstone, laboratory bench tops, tombstones and that of Pseudotachylite are creating artwork, gemstone.
